Sloyan has been used as a voice-over actor for Sprint Nextel long distance services, and in film trailers for movies such as Jumper, The Shadow and How to Make an American Quilt[3].

Sloyan was also "the voice of Lexus" [4], having performed voice-overs in American television advertisements for Lexus (a division of Toyota Motor Corporation), since the make's introduction to the American market.

In 2009, he was replaced as the "voice of Lexus" by actor James Remar. Sloyan now voices ads for Mitsubishi.
